TECHNOLOGY TRENDS

A new Navineo infographic in vehicles

Ineo Systrans integrates the new screen format trends (16/9 or extra-wide) and offers easy and legible information throughout the vehicle’s journey: a dynamic line diagram alternating with pages dedicated to commercial messages, points of interest and connections.

A line diagram is automatically built, based on the line description and the applicable control actions: it shows the previous stop, the vehicle location, future stops, connected lines and the final destination.

It also displays the estimated time of arrival at main stops, the non-covered and temporary stops due to diversions. Using an extra-wide screen allows a richer presentation of the number of stops.

This infographic also reassures those passengers who will use other transportation modes, such as the train by displaying all downstream connection times. It is also possible to alternate passenger information with images related to points of interest and to schedule text or graphical messages.

  • BRUSSELS :
    Maintenance contract in Brussels.

    The public transportation operator of Brussels (STIB) signed a maintenance contract for its 1.500 Tactileo driver consoles and for the CAD/AVL software developed by Ineo Systrans.

    This maintenance contract runs through 2021 and it involves a 24/7 assistance.

    Won in 2007, the CAD/AVL and RTPI system allows STIB to control its fleet of 630 buses and 350 trams.

Project life

The transportation network of Le Havre launches LiA app to simplify travel

March 26, 2015, LiA network operator (Transdev) presented a free smartphone application that provides buses and trams real-time passenger information, the nearest stop-and the disturbances. “This multi-purpose tool reduces the uncertainties of transport and reassures users” summarized Sylvain Picard, LiA Managing Director.

Ineo Systrans provided the Computer Aided Dispatch, Automatic Vehicle Location and Passenger Information system for Le Havre tram and bus network.

“The system meets its objectives and reliability levels were achieved on time. Two years after its commissioning, the CAD/AVL has been fully integrated with the operating teams, at the Operation Center and on site” said Sylvain Picard. “I had a good experience with the system deployment. Ineo Systrans’ team demonstrated a high level of responsiveness and cooperation during this important transition.”

LiA transportation network signed in late 2014 a software and hardware maintenance contract for 3 years, including a 24/7 assistance call.
